RenaissanceRe (NYSE:RNR) Price Target Raised to $342.00

RenaissanceRe (NYSE:RNRGet Free Report) had its price target upped by research analysts at Keefe, Bruyette & Woods from $327.00 to $342.00 in a research note issued on Wednesday,Benzinga reports. The firm presently has a “market perform” rating on the insurance provider’s stock. Keefe, Bruyette & Woods’ price target indicates a potential upside of 4.61% from the company’s previous close.

RNR has been the subject of a number of other reports. Barclays increased their price target on RenaissanceRe from $328.00 to $341.00 and gave the stock an “equal weight” rating in a report on Tuesday. Wall Street Zen cut shares of RenaissanceRe from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research report on Saturday, May 2nd. Bank of America lowered their target price on shares of RenaissanceRe to $426.00 and set a “buy” rating for the company in a research note on Tuesday, April 14th. Morgan Stanley lifted their price target on shares of RenaissanceRe from $310.00 to $320.00 and gave the company an “equal weight” rating in a research report on Monday. Finally, Wolfe Research set a $315.00 price target on shares of RenaissanceRe in a research note on Tuesday. Five anal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, eleven have assigned a Hold rating and one has assigned a Sell r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at.com, the stock has a consensus rating of “Hold” and an average price target of $328.33.

RenaissanceRe Trading Up 1.0%

Shares of NYSE RNR traded up $3.24 during midday trading on Wednesday, reaching $326.93. 47,946 shares of the st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 366,594. The stock has a market capitalization of $13.94 billion, a P/E ratio of 5.45, a PEG ratio of 1.22 and a beta of 0.17.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.22, a quick ratio of 1.37 and a current ratio of 1.37. The company has a 50 day simple moving average of $300.30 and a 200 day simple moving average of $295.00. RenaissanceRe has a twelve month low of $231.17 and a twelve month high of $329.57.

RenaissanceRe (NYSE:RNRG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, March 31st. The insurance provider reported $13.75 earnings per share for the quarter. The company had revenue of $2.19 billion during the quarter. RenaissanceRe had a return on equity of 24.01% and a net margin of 24.25%. As a group, equities analysts expect that RenaissanceRe will post 40.05 earnings per share for the current year.

About RenaissanceRe

RenaissanceRe Holdings Ltd. is a global provider of reinsurance and insurance solutions, specializing in property catastrophe, casualty, and specialty lines. Established in 1993 and headquartered in Bermuda, the company trades on the New York Stock Exchange under the symbol RNR. With a focus on underwriting and risk assessment, RenaissanceRe offers tailored programs designed to help insurers and corporations manage exposure to natural disasters, liability claims, and other complex risks.

The company operates through two primary segments: Reinsurance and Insurance.
